Output 5a937e401164af5f7d5cc9b6eed18b56a667f8c325cdf7d5a0b5782c4b7eb0ba:0

value
343490910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 466630d5292caf701e15c5cbee58a3607f396e26 OP_EQUAL
address
MEKPxCLYxVFVmzuTChoEWmH4sBLuPzCiSZ
transaction
5a937e401164af5f7d5cc9b6eed18b56a667f8c325cdf7d5a0b5782c4b7eb0ba
spent
true